Output 75625470307f8305d26ef6652d334407f5cd7ddc825e83ba0444e92ae611247e:0

value
18000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d19eb861ba966c4acca40a127d1589711366153 OP_EQUAL
address
34Lta4VeUx32TQfoKmNBF1F2kzYVTcWFE5
transaction
75625470307f8305d26ef6652d334407f5cd7ddc825e83ba0444e92ae611247e
spent
true